Lady Rams fall to Oklahoma Christian, 88-80
November 23, 2004

Box Score

     FORT WORTH, Texas -
The Lady Rams dropped to 1-3 on the season after an 88-80 loss to the undefeated Lady Eagles of Oklahoma Christian Tuesday evening at the Sid Richardson Gymnasium.

     Junior forward Kashae Townsend dropped 19 points and gathered a game-high 17 rebounds to lead the Lady Rams in both categories. Her effort was overshadowed by five Lady Eagles scoring in double-digits. Oklahoma Christian guard Lauren Decker registered a game-high 24 points on 50 percent shooting to lead the Lady Eagles offensively.

     The Lady Eagles (7-0) began the game on a 9-0 run through the first two minutes of the contest. OCU played behind the strength of a team lights-out shooting performance in the first half, in which they knocked down 41 percent of their shots from the field, including 66 percent from beyond the arc.

     Despite shooting only 36 percent and committing 13 turnovers in the first frame, the Lady Rams closed their deficit to only six points at the half, 39-33, on the back of a 6-0 run in last three minutes.

     While the Lady Rams' overall shooting performance from the floor improved in the second half, their three-point shooting was unfruitful as the team went 0-7 for the half. The Lady Rams did step up their defensive effort as they forced the Lady Eagles into 10 turnovers in the second half. Wesleyan then erased their deficit on a Townsend lay-in with 13:22 remaining that made the count 51-50 in favor of the Lady Rams.

     A lay-up by OCU forward Carlissa Plowden three minutes later, however, would put the Lady Rams down for the rest of the game, as the Lady Eagles only continued to heat up. The Lady Eagles connected on 60 percent of their attempts from the floor, including a perfect 3-for-3 from behind the arc in the second half.

     Plowden led the Lady Eagles in the second frame with 15 points. OCU shot 50 percent on the night, including 77 percent from behind the three-point line. Forward Tasha Turney scored 12 and grabbed 10 boards. Forward Katie Fariss shot 5-for-6 from the three-point line, scoring 17 points and pulling down 10 rebounds. Rachel Martin chipped in with 12 points for the Lady Eagles.

     The Lady Rams shot a dismal 41.9 percent from the field, including 16.7 percent from the three-point line for the game. Forward Nastassia Brown registered 12 points and five boards in only 16 minutes for the Lady Rams. Sophomore forward Shawndrika Courtney scored 11 points and added seven rebounds before fouling out with just less than four and a half minutes remaining. Junior guard Tiffany Hill had game-highs of five assists and three steals.

     The Lady Rams return to action Friday when they travel to take on St. Gregory's in the OBU Classic in Shawnee, Okla. Tip-off is set for 2 p.m. They will take on host Oklahoma Baptist Saturday at 6 p.m.
